Dataflows - Refresh Dataflow
Belirtilen veri akışı için yenilemeyi tetikler.
MailOnFailure ve NoNotification, desteklenen e-posta bildirim seçenekleridir. MailOnCompletion desteklenmez.
İzinler
Bu API çağrısı bir hizmet sorumlusu profili tarafından çağrılabilir. Daha fazla bilgi için bkz. Power BI Embedded hizmet sorumlusu profilleri.
Gerekli Kapsam
Dataflow.ReadWrite.All
POST https://api.powerbi.com/v1.0/myorg/groups/{groupId}/dataflows/{dataflowId}/refreshes
POST https://api.powerbi.com/v1.0/myorg/groups/{groupId}/dataflows/{dataflowId}/refreshes?processType={processType}
URI Parametreleri
Name | İçinde | Gerekli | Tür | Description |
---|---|---|---|---|
dataflow
|
path | True |
string uuid |
Veri akışı kimliği |
group
|
path | True |
string uuid |
Çalışma alanı kimliği |
process
|
query |
string |
Kullanılacak yenileme işleminin türü. |
İstek Gövdesi
Name | Gerekli | Tür | Description |
---|---|---|---|
notifyOption | True |
Posta bildirim seçenekleri |
Yanıtlar
Name | Tür | Description |
---|---|---|
200 OK |
Tamam |
Örnekler
Example
Örnek isteği
POST https://api.powerbi.com/v1.0/myorg/groups/51e47fc5-48fd-4826-89f0-021bd3a80abd/dataflows/928228ba-008d-4fd9-864a-92d2752ee5ce/refreshes?processType=default
{
"notifyOption": "MailOnFailure"
}
Örnek yanıt
Tanımlar
Name | Description |
---|---|
Notify |
Posta bildirim seçenekleri |
Refresh |
Power BI yenileme isteği |
NotifyOption
Posta bildirim seçenekleri
Değer | Description |
---|---|
MailOnCompletion |
Yenileme tamamlandığında başarılı veya başarısız olduğunu belirten bir posta bildirimi gönderilecek |
MailOnFailure |
Yenileme hatasında bir posta bildirimi gönderilecek |
NoNotification |
Bildirim gönderilmeyecek |
RefreshRequest
Power BI yenileme isteği
Name | Tür | Description |
---|---|---|
notifyOption |
Posta bildirim seçenekleri |